WHY SHOULD I COME TO BLACK LOVE SUMMIT?
We’re so glad you asked because this is not your typical “conference”! As a matter of fact, we don’t even use that word. We work diligently to bring the rawness and vulnerability you’ve seen in the Black Love docu-series, here on BlackLove.com, and our many digital shows and podcasts to you LIVE in person! The Black Love Summit gathers Black singles and couples for transparent conversations about love, partnership, and community. The best part?! The creators of the Black Love docu-series, Tommy & Codie Elaine Oliver, bring some of your favorite couples from the series along with talent from the Black Love family to talk about everything from dating to sex to parenting and prioritizing your mental health on top of that! (Heavy on the mental health.) For this 5th anniversary year, we are closing out the day with the RNB HouseParty featuring a performance by Coco Jones!

WHAT CAN I EXPECT AT BLACK LOVE SUMMIT?
Come expecting to feel seen and safe. This is a safe space for Black singles and couples in any stage of life. Whether you’re married, single, searching for sisterhood (or brotherhood — fellas, get your tickets!), healing from past relationship trauma, dating with intention, or divorced, it doesn’t matter. We meet you where you are. No matter where you are on your journey, you deserve every form of Black love: self, communal, and the love shared between a couple.

WHAT BLACK LOVE ALUMS CAN I EXPECT TO SEE AT THE SUMMIT?
Day one Black Love Doc fans know that what makes Black Love Summit extra special is the up close and personal interactions experience with your favs from Black Love Doc and our Black Love Family! This year Nina Westbrook & Russell Westbrook, Melaina Fiona, Angel Laketa Moore, Chance Brown, Mattie James, Kier Gaines, and Adrienne Banfield Norris (aka Gammy) and more join us, now all that’s missing is you!
